    I was shooting a crow out of my pecan tree with my 22-250, and the 2002 PreRunner alarm system went off!

    The truck was parked about 20 feet from the muzzle of the gun (no, not in the line of fire). I imagine it was the glass-break sensor that got set off by the sound/muzzle blast.

    Oh, and the crow won't be eating any more of my pecans ;)
